Welcome to the EUCOSSA app! This is an Android application designed specifically for computer science students at Egerton University. Our goal is to create a vibrant community where students can communicate, share ideas, collaborate on projects, and have fun.
- Real-time Chat: Connect with fellow students through instant messaging.
- Idea Sharing: Post and discuss ideas, projects, and technical concepts.
- Collaboration: Join groups to work on projects together.
- Events & Activities: Stay updated on upcoming events, workshops, and other activities.
- User Profiles: Customize your profile and connect with like-minded peers.
- Kotlin & Java: The app is developed using Kotlin and Java, making the most of Android's robust development ecosystem.
- Firebase: For real-time data synchronization and authentication.
- Material Design: Ensuring a smooth, user-friendly interface that follows Android's design guidelines.
- MVVM: A robust architecture pattern for separating logic from the UI.
- Android Studio installed on your machine.
- A Firebase account for backend services.